1986 Audi 90 vs. 2005 Saturn ION
To start off, 2005 Saturn ION is newer by 19 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1986 Audi 90.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1986 Audi 90 would be higher. At 2,196 cc (4 cylinders), 2005 Saturn ION is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Saturn ION (140 HP) has 26 more horse power than 1986 Audi 90. (114 HP) In normal driving conditions, 2005 Saturn ION should accelerate faster than 1986 Audi 90.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2005 Saturn ION weights approximately 194 kg more than 1986 Audi 90.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Let's talk about torque, 2005 Saturn ION (197 Nm) has 28 more torque (in Nm) than 1986 Audi 90. (169 Nm). This means 2005 Saturn ION will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1986 Audi 90.
